New Orleans, Louisiana (CNN) — The annual State of the Black Union forum boasted a number of famous attendees in New Orleans on Saturday, but this year’s event received much more attention for who wasn’t there.

Sen. Hillary Clinton, D-New York, was the only major presidential candidate to accept an invitation to attend.
Her rival, Illinois Sen. Barack Obama, declined, as did Republican presidential hopeful Sen. John McCain of Arizona.
Clinton told the crowd Saturday evening the country stands at a historic moment.
“How many of our parents and our grandparents, and how many of us ever thought we would see the day when a woman or an African-American would be the Democratic nominee for president of the United States,” she said.
But Clinton also acknowledged experiencing “painful moments” during the campaign, which she called very challenging and incredibly competitive.
“The high stakes and historic nature of Sen. Obama’s candidacy and mine have invested this campaign with an intensity and an excitement seldom seen in the political arena,” she said.
Meanwhile, Obama’s absence at the forum has prompted both controversy and a backlash against Tavis Smiley, the organizer of the event who has openly criticized Obama’s decision.
In a letter to Smiley earlier this month, Obama commended the forum for addressing important issues, but explained he needed to focus on his presidential run ahead of the critical March 4 primaries.
